Match sign up goes live at 5pm the Friday before the match. Meet in the classroom for safety brief before going down to the range. Cost is $25 plus tax per shooter. The Range St. Louis West 2Gun Series is a battle for the title of “Awesome-ness”. The 2025 Season will begin on Thursday, March 13th and will run until November. Click the link to PractiScore to sign up, and see results after each individual match. Results will also be posted on this page shortly after each match along with the season up-to-date leaders. The points series is a set of 10 matches held once monthly with 3 (or more) stages at each match. Each shooter will be awarded points based on their placement within that month’s match. At the end of the 10 monthly matches the Top 4 will automatically qualify for the finals, with shooters #5-12 qualifying for a Semi-Finals match the 11th month. Top 4 from the Semi-finals will qualify for the final 8 man shoot-off to earn the title of Series Winner. Required Gear+ You will need a rifle, pistol, holster, mag pouches for a rifle and pistol, 3 or more magazines for each firearm, eye and ear protection and a belt. Bring at least 100 rounds for each platform, and be ready to help paste targets. Rules For Two Gun Series Competition+ The matches will be held on the 2nd Thursday each month from 6pm to 9pm. * dates are subject to change* $25 a shooter per match. 20 shooter cap per match with sign up on Practiscore. Shooters top 5 match points will be totaled up for the full series point standing. IDPA is a shooting sport based on defensive pistol techniques, using equipment including full-charge service ammunition to solve simulated “real world” self-defense scenarios. Shooters competing in defensive pistol events are required to use practical handguns and holsters that are deemed suitable for self-defense use. Great for new shooter and those who want to get practice with their CCW set up. We will shoot 3 or more stages per match. Rules and sign up for IDPA at www. idpa. com IDPA Matches are on the 1st Thursday each month starting at 6pm. Competition Skills and Drills take place on the last Thursday of every month, and also begin at 6pm. Sign ups for both go live at 6pm on the Friday before both event on the PractiScore website. Meet in the classroom for the safety brief before going down to the range. Cost is $20 plus tax per shooter. *Participants using AIWB holsters must be classified at a high-level in shooting sports, or have a Holster Draw Certification as a member of The Range. If neither are present, they will be asked to demonstrate safe drawing and holstering by performing dry runs before their first live-fire run through a stage. Required Gear+ Either OWB (Outside Waist Band) or AIWB (Appendix Inside Waist Band)* holster, mag pouches, 3 or more magazines, belt, eye and ear protection and a cover garment of some kind (ie: vest, jacket, shirt) to hide your firearm and mags. Bring at least 100 rounds to the match. --- - Published: 2026-04-15 - Modified: 2026-04-16 - URL: http://staging.therangestl.com/competition/ Interested in trying competition shooting, or seeing the latest results? Know the guidelines to ensure a safe experience for all. - Published: 2026-01-23 - Modified: 2026-02-09 - URL: http://staging.therangestl.com/shooting-range/range-rules/ Instruction provided by outside entities is strictly prohibited without prior approval from The Range’s Training Department. THE RANGE staff reserves the right to deny access to the range for any reason. Always keep the muzzle of your firearm pointed downrange. Always keep your finger outside the trigger guard until you have your sights aligned on your target. All firearms must be unloaded with the action open and visible unless you are shooting that particular firearm. Only one firearm may be loaded in any booth at any point in time. Maximum of three persons are permitted in one lane. Only one person may shoot at a time. Case and uncase all firearms only in your booth with the muzzle pointed downrange at all times. All firearms entering the building must be in a case. Personal firearms may only be holstered in your booth. All firearms must arrive and leave the shooting booth in a case or bin. No un-holstered firearms may leave the booth. No one is permitted on the range under the influence of drugs, alcohol or any controlled substance. Firearms and ammo may be inspected at the check-in counter at staff’s request. Any firearms or ammunition found to be unsafe or unserviceable will not be permitted on the range. All firearms entering the range are subject to approval by THE RANGE staff. Permissible calibers: Rifles up to . 30 cal / Handguns up to 50 AE. Steel cased/cored ammo and tracer/incendiary rounds ARE NOT allowed. Shotguns may only use 00 Buck or slugs. Eye and ear protection must be worn at all times while in the shooting bays.... --- > Host your next event at The Range STL West. Officers are required to take a 2-day (16-hour) class before obtaining an armed license. This training consists of basic firearm safety, private security rules for handling of firearms, function, care, and cleaning of a semi-automatic pistol, and the fundamentals of marksmanship. Topics covered and skills reinforced+ Basic firearms safety Private Security rules for handling firearm Use of Force, Missouri Statutes, and applicable case law Semi-Auto function and manipulation Loading/unloading Fundamentals of marksmanship Advanced techniques on range Required Gear+ Eye and Ear Protection Approved firearm (see requirements HERE) 300 rounds of ammunition (NOT INCLUDED) 3 magazines Duty Belt Approved level 2 holster (see requirements HERE) Magazine pouches Closed toed shoes --- - Published: 2026-04-17 - Modified: 2026-04-17 - URL: http://staging.therangestl.com/firearms-training/private-security-firearm-qualification/ - Categories: Private Security Training - Training Categories: Private Security This qualification is for private security officers or couriers in St. Louis County and St. Louis City for their semi-annual or annual license renewal. Officers are required to pass a 50-round qualification where 35/50 rounds must hit within the 7 ring and the head on a standard B27 silhouette target. Qualification is guided and scored by an instructor. If an officer is unable to qualify, private security will be notified, and private training may be scheduled at a discounted rate. The private training may also include a qualification should the instructor deem it appropriate. Topics covered and skills reinforced+ Basic firearms safety Private Security rules for handling firearm Required Gear+ Eye and Ear Protection Firearm that you carry on duty 50 rounds of ammunition (INCLUDED) 3 magazines (semi-auto) 2 speed loaders (revolver) Duty Belt Approved level 2 holster Magazine/speed loader pouches Closed toed shoes --- > Earn your holster draw certification at The Range STL West. Please note that your class may not have this testing. Passing & Rules+ 12rds for Mild Standard You are allowed one redo per standard. Starting positions are as follows: Hands relaxed, at side. All hits must be in the A zone or head zone of our VTAC target to count. A time bonus will be added to the following holsters: OWB No Active Retention: no bonus OWB level 2 holster or IWB Concealed: -. 10 to overall time OWB Level 3 holster: -. 20 to overall time Mild Standard+ Stage 1: 3yds: From the draw, 3 to the chest 2 to the head / (5rds total) within 2. 5 seconds. Hits must be in ‘A’ zone and head box. Stage 2: 7yds: From the draw, 1rd within 1. 25 seconds. Hits must be in the ‘A’ zone. Stage 3: 10yds: From the draw, 6rds within 3. 25 seconds. Certifications The program will provide an in-depth understanding of all components, parts, and maintenance of the AR-15/M-4 Rifle. Have you ever broken down your AR and asked yourself “How do I get this back together? ” or “What is the torque specification on this nut? ” Well, we have the answer to all your AR questions. This 2-day course will present comprehensive and detailed exposure to the AR-15/M-4 Rifle. This is not an AR overview class. Each student will leave with a very enhanced knowledge of the AR system, assembly, tear-down, repair, diagnosis and maintenance of the AR-15/M-4 rifle. All rifles, parts, tools, and materials will be provided for the student to participate and accomplish the class objective. This is a Missouri P. O. S. T. recognized 16-hour qualification for Continuing Education Skills: Firearms for Missouri Law Enforcement Officers. Topics covered and skills reinforced+ Understand the safety principles involved with AR-15/M-16 Weapon System. Proper Nomenclature of each part. Identify all parts and assemblies of the AR-15/M-16 Rifle. Understand the function of each part. Assemble & disassemble the complete Upper Receiver Group. Assemble & disassemble the complete Barrel Assembly. Assemble & disassemble the complete Lower Receiver Group. Identify & replace defective or broken parts. Order proper parts for repair. Obtain technical knowledge of various trigger groups. Obtain technical knowledge of Gas System requirements & operation. Diagnose problems. Knowledge of optional & necessary equipment selection. Installation of optional & necessary equipment selection.
